Starting Point and Logistics
The adventure begins at Lacanau Surf Explore, located at 22 Av. Henri Seguin. This accessible meeting point is close to public transport, making it convenient for most travelers. The tour runs from mid-March to mid-November, covering prime surfing seasons in southern France. With a maximum of four travelers, the small group size means you’ll get lots of personalized guidance without feeling lost in a crowd.
The Electric Bike Ride: Freedom and Discovery
Once everyone is geared up, the journey kicks off with about an hour of electric bike riding. The bikes are described as easy to handle and very pleasant, perfect even for those new to e-biking. The route follows picturesque trails through pine forests and along wild coastlines, revealing hidden beaches that typical travelers might never discover.
This part of the tour is more than just transportation; it’s a chance to learn about the region’s geology, flora, and fauna. Damien, the guide, shares his deep regional knowledge, pointing out stunning vistas and secret spots along the way. Frequently Asked Questions
Is this experience suitable for beginners?
Absolutely. The tour is designed to adapt to all levels of surfing experience. Many reviews mention that Damien is very pedagogical and attentive, making it a great choice for first-timers.
How long is the electric bike ride?
The bike exploration lasts about an hour round trip, covering scenic trails through pine forests and along the coast, giving you time to soak in the views without feeling rushed.
What should I bring for the activity?
You might find it helpful to wear comfortable outdoor clothing, bring sunscreen, and perhaps a hat. The tour provides bikes, boards, and guidance, so additional gear isn’t necessary unless you want your own.
Will I be able to catch waves regardless of my skill level?
Yes. Damien personalizes each surf session, ensuring you’re guided at your comfort and skill level. Many reviewers highlight how supportive and positive the instruction is.
What is the maximum group size?
The tour limits to four travelers, which guarantees personalized attention and a peaceful atmosphere.
What happens if the weather is bad?
Since good weather is required, the tour can be canceled or rescheduled in case of poor conditions. You’ll be offered a different date or a full refund if that happens.
